12466984
0x6f723ee44e4b7e110f840bf3607ff5aa801ade4d27e40c4d1336bbc83475e090
Transactions139
Height12466984
Confirmations6959479
Timestamp1104 days 11 hours ago
Size (bytes)43663
Version
Merkle Root
Nonce0xa962ea4e023ebc64
Bits
Difficulty0x1d52edd73239d6

Transactions

mined 1104 days 11 hours ago
Failed
0x18cbafe5
ERC20 Token Transfers